But ah! my eyes, when turned upon myself, lose all sight of thee, and meet nothing but my own spots and blemishes.
How canst thou love me? I say; and for thy pure love I am melted into thee as one." He continues: "Lord, let me speak of my many and grievous sins; but oh! when I would do so, my mouth speaks nothing forth but Thy praises. "I would offer my whole soul afresh to all that is, for the sake of the love of God.
